What you’ll do

We are looking for a Senior Product Manager (x/f/m) to join our Financial Solutions domain.

As a Senior Product Manager (x/f/m), your mission will be to define, prioritize, and manage the launch of our innovative private billing platform that transforms how healthcare providers manage their finances.

  • Own and execute the product strategy for our private billing platform, serving healthcare providers across multiple countries
  • Lead the German market expansion, scaling from MVP to full market solution while incorporating user feedback and market insights
  • Drive the product strategy for non-medics specialties financial solutions
  • Partner with the online payment team to create seamless end-to-end experiences for healthcare providers and patients
  • Define and execute the roadmap for transforming manual billing processes into digital experiences
  • Work cross-functionally with development teams, user researchers, designers, and data analysts in an agile environment
  • Contribute to strategic initiatives through stakeholder management and best-practice implementation
